Transaction 100266b0e76fa8c4e5c5bcbbc61ab1e8fd31eddacc4a8f7caba24f87889e32a5
1 Input
1 Output
-
100266b0e76fa8c4e5c5bcbbc61ab1e8fd31eddacc4a8f7caba24f87889e32a5:0
- value
- 143830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c8e798427106ca9fa917329c92fab05992a347a OP_EQUAL
- address
- 3D3cPeLU3U8k6RCjTFY4KgoHTyuRZcSZPs